🚀 Elevate Your Game with the Dell XPS 8950!
The Dell XPS 8950 Desktop is a powerhouse featuring a 12th Gen Intel Core i7-12700K processor, 16GB DDR5 RAM, and a dedicated N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 with 12GB of GDDR6 memory. It combines a 512GB SSD with a 1TB HDD for ample storage, while Wi-Fi 6 technology ensures lightning-fast connectivity. Designed for thermal efficiency, this desktop is perfect for gamers and professionals seeking high performance and easy access to internal components.

Dell XPS 8950 Desktop - 12th Gen Intel Core i7-12700- NO HDMI video out-DP port only
I reverted to Windows 10 as I do not like W11.Pros:Very fast PC, once you get things running.There are TWO SSD NVME slots on the motherboard, so you can have two very fast drives.Quiet running, low fan noise.Newer USB such as USB-CGEN 4 PCIeCONS:Probably won't work 'right out of the box'. May be difficult to get it running.It was difficult to find a DP-> HDMI converter that will work with this. Below is a link to one that will workFIRST you need to go into BIOS and change the -RAID- to -NVME- if you want to add any additional NVME or SATA SSD storage. Dell seems to like RAID for some reason. Once you change to NVME windows will need to be reinstalled. 2 PCIe x4 slots an 1 PCIE x16 slot- UNFORTUNATELY the x16 slot CANNOT be used for anything but a video card, Plug anything else in and the video display won't work.DP-> hdmi cablehttps://www.amazon.com/gp/product/B015OW3M1W/ref=ppx_yo_dt_b_search_asin_title?ie=UTF8&th=1
